Backsplash repair services involve fixing damage or deterioration to the tiled or paneling surfaces installed behind sinks, stoves, and countertops in kitchens and bathrooms. Over time, these surfaces can develop cracks, chips, or looseness due to everyday use, moisture exposure, or accidental impacts. Skilled service providers can restore the appearance and functionality of the backsplash, ensuring it continues to serve as a protective and decorative element in the space. Repair work typically includes re-securing loose tiles, filling in cracks, replacing damaged sections, and resealing to prevent further issues.
Many common problems lead homeowners to seek backsplash repair services. Cracks and chips can occur from accidental bumps or heavy objects, while water damage may cause tiles to loosen or develop mold and mildew underneath. Grout lines can also deteriorate or stain over time, compromising the barrier against moisture and debris. Repairing these issues not only improves the visual appeal of the kitchen or bathroom but also helps prevent more extensive damage that could require complete replacement of the backsplash.

The overview below groups typical Backsplash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- typical costs for minor backsplash repairs range from $250 to $600, covering patching, regrouting, or small cracks.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, depending on the scope of work and materials used.
Moderate Renovations - more extensive repairs or partial replacements usually cost between $600 and $1,500. Larger, more complex projects can reach higher amounts but remain less common than mid-range jobs.
Full Backsplash Replacement - replacing an entire backsplash often costs from $1,500 to $3,000, depending on size, material choices, and labor. Many local contractors handle these projects within this range, with some high-end designs exceeding it.
Custom or Large-Scale Projects - large or intricate backsplash installations can cost $3,000 and above, especially for premium materials or custom designs. These projects are less frequent but represent the higher end of typical project costs handled by local pros.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
